| /openbsd/src/gnu/usr.bin/perl/cpan/Test-Simple/t/Test2/behavior/ |
| D | no_load_api.t | 9 # This test is to insure certain objects do not load Test2::API directly or # 10 # indirectly when being required. It is ok for import() to load Test2::API if # 15 require Test2::Formatter; 16 require Test2::Formatter::TAP; 18 require Test2::Event; 19 require Test2::Event::Bail; 20 require Test2::Event::Diag; 21 require Test2::Event::Exception; 22 require Test2::Event::Note; 23 require Test2::Event::Ok; [all …]
|
| D | trace_signature.t | 4 use Test2::Tools::Tiny; 5 use Test2::API qw/intercept context/; 6 use Test2::Util qw/get_tid/; 29 my $trace = Test2::EventFacet::Trace->new(frame => ['main', 'foo.t', 42, 'xxx']); 36 my $e = Test2::Event::Ok->new(pass => 1); 39 $e = Test2::Event::Ok->new(pass => 1, trace => Test2::EventFacet::Trace->new(frame => ['', '', '', … 42 $e = Test2::Event::Ok->new(pass => 1, trace => Test2::EventFacet::Trace->new(frame => []));
|
| D | disable_ipc_a.t | 4 no Test2::IPC; 5 use Test2::Tools::Tiny; 6 use Test2::IPC::Driver::Files; 8 ok(Test2::API::test2_ipc_disabled, "disabled IPC"); 9 ok(!Test2::API::test2_ipc, "No IPC");
|
| /openbsd/src/gnu/usr.bin/perl/ |
| D | Makefile.bsd-wrapper1 | 699 Test2 3p lib/Test2.pm \ 700 Test2::API 3p lib/Test2/API.pm \ 701 Test2::API::Breakage 3p lib/Test2/API/Breakage.pm \ 702 Test2::API::Context 3p lib/Test2/API/Context.pm \ 703 Test2::API::Instance 3p lib/Test2/API/Instance.pm \ 704 Test2::API::InterceptResult 3p lib/Test2/API/InterceptResult.pm \ 705 Test2::API::InterceptResult::Event 3p lib/Test2/API/InterceptResult/Event.pm \ 706 Test2::API::InterceptResult::Hub 3p lib/Test2/API/InterceptResult/Hub.pm \ 707 Test2::API::InterceptResult::Squasher 3p lib/Test2/API/InterceptResult/Squasher.pm \ 708 Test2::API::Stack 3p lib/Test2/API/Stack.pm \ [all …]
|
| /openbsd/src/gnu/usr.bin/perl/cpan/Test-Simple/t/Test2/modules/ |
| D | Event.t | 3 use Test2::Tools::Tiny; 5 use Test2::Event(); 6 use Test2::EventFacet::Trace(); 7 use Test2::Event::Generic; 9 use Test2::API qw/context/; 16 use base 'Test2::Event'; 17 use Test2::Util::HashBase qw/foo bar baz/; 46 …my $e = Test2::Event->new(trace => Test2::EventFacet::Trace->new(frame => ['foo', 'foo.pl', 42], n… 61 …like($warnings->[0], qr/Use of Test2::Event->nested\(\) is deprecated/, "Warned about deprecation"… 62 …like($warnings->[1], qr/Use of Test2::Event->in_subtest\(\) is deprecated/, "Warned about deprecat… [all …]
|
| D | API.t | 6 use Test2::API qw/context/; 10 $INIT = Test2::API::test2_init_done; 11 $LOADED = Test2::API::test2_load_done; 14 use Test2::IPC; 15 use Test2::Tools::Tiny; 16 use Test2::Util qw/get_tid/; 17 my $CLASS = 'Test2::API'; 20 ok(Test2::API->can($_), "$_ method is present") for qw{ 59 ok(Test2::API::test2_load_done, "We loaded it"); 75 Test2::API::test2_add_callback_exit( [all …]
|
| D | Hub.t | 4 use Test2::IPC; 5 use Test2::Tools::Tiny; 6 use Test2::API qw/context test2_ipc_drivers/; 7 use Test2::Util qw/CAN_FORK CAN_THREAD CAN_REALLY_FORK/; 25 use base 'Test2::Event'; 26 use Test2::Util::HashBase qw{msg}; 30 my $hub = Test2::Hub->new( 36 …my $e = My::Event->new(msg => $msg, trace => Test2::EventFacet::Trace->new(frame => ['fake', 'fake… 55 my $hub = Test2::Hub->new; 58 my $trace = Test2::EventFacet::Trace->new( [all …]
|
| D | IPC.t | 4 use Test2::IPC qw/cull/; 5 use Test2::API qw/context test2_ipc_drivers test2_ipc intercept/; 7 use Test2::Tools::Tiny; 13 ['Test2::IPC::Driver::Files'], 19 ok(eval { intercept { Test2::IPC->import }; 1 }, "Can re-import Test2::IPC without error") or diag …
|
| /openbsd/src/gnu/usr.bin/perl/cpan/Test-Simple/lib/Test2/Util/ |
| D | HashBase.pm | 1 package Test2::Util::HashBase; 19 $Test2::Util::HashBase::HB_VERSION = '0.009'; 20 *Test2::Util::HashBase::ATTR_SUBS = \%Object::HashBase::ATTR_SUBS; 21 *Test2::Util::HashBase::ATTR_LIST = \%Object::HashBase::ATTR_LIST; 22 *Test2::Util::HashBase::VERSION = \%Object::HashBase::VERSION; 23 *Test2::Util::HashBase::CAN_CACHE = \%Object::HashBase::CAN_CACHE; 60 my $ver = $Test2::Util::HashBase::HB_VERSION || $Test2::Util::HashBase::VERSION; 61 …$Test2::Util::HashBase::VERSION{$into} = $ver if !$Test2::Util::HashBase::VERSION{$into} || $Test2… 64 my $attr_list = $Test2::Util::HashBase::ATTR_LIST{$into} ||= []; 65 my $attr_subs = $Test2::Util::HashBase::ATTR_SUBS{$into} ||= {}; [all …]
|
| /openbsd/src/gnu/usr.bin/perl/cpan/Test-Simple/t/Test2/modules/Event/ |
| D | Plan.t | 4 use Test2::Tools::Tiny; 5 use Test2::Event::Plan; 6 use Test2::EventFacet::Trace; 8 my $plan = Test2::Event::Plan->new( 9 trace => Test2::EventFacet::Trace->new(frame => [__PACKAGE__, __FILE__, __LINE__]), 36 $plan = Test2::Event::Plan->new( 37 trace => Test2::EventFacet::Trace->new(frame => [__PACKAGE__, __FILE__, __LINE__]), 43 $plan = Test2::Event::Plan->new( 44 trace => Test2::EventFacet::Trace->new(frame => [__PACKAGE__, __FILE__, __LINE__]), 53 $plan = Test2::Event::Plan->new( [all …]
|
| D | Note.t | 4 use Test2::Tools::Tiny; 5 use Test2::Event::Note; 6 use Test2::EventFacet::Trace; 8 my $note = Test2::Event::Note->new( 9 trace => Test2::EventFacet::Trace->new(frame => [__PACKAGE__, __FILE__, __LINE__]), 15 $note = Test2::Event::Note->new( 16 trace => Test2::EventFacet::Trace->new(frame => [__PACKAGE__, __FILE__, __LINE__]), 23 $note = Test2::Event::Note->new( 24 trace => Test2::EventFacet::Trace->new(frame => [__PACKAGE__, __FILE__, __LINE__]), 30 $note = Test2::Event::Note->new( [all …]
|
| D | Diag.t | 3 use Test2::Tools::Tiny; 4 use Test2::Event::Diag; 5 use Test2::EventFacet::Trace; 7 my $diag = Test2::Event::Diag->new( 8 trace => Test2::EventFacet::Trace->new(frame => [__PACKAGE__, __FILE__, __LINE__]), 14 $diag = Test2::Event::Diag->new( 15 trace => Test2::EventFacet::Trace->new(frame => [__PACKAGE__, __FILE__, __LINE__]), 22 $diag = Test2::Event::Diag->new( 23 trace => Test2::EventFacet::Trace->new(frame => [__PACKAGE__, __FILE__, __LINE__]), 31 $diag = Test2::Event::Diag->new( [all …]
|
| D | Subtest.t | 4 use Test2::Tools::Tiny; 5 use Test2::Event::Subtest; 6 my $st = 'Test2::Event::Subtest'; 8 my $trace = Test2::EventFacet::Trace->new(frame => [__PACKAGE__, __FILE__, __LINE__, 'xxx']); 17 ok($one->isa('Test2::Event::Ok'), "Inherit from Ok"); 30 require Test2::Event::Pass; 31 push @{$one->subevents} => Test2::Event::Pass->new(name => 'xxx'); 45 package => 'Test2::Event::Pass', 73 package => 'Test2::Event::Pass',
|
| D | Bail.t | 3 use Test2::Tools::Tiny; 4 use Test2::Event::Bail; 5 use Test2::EventFacet::Trace; 7 my $bail = Test2::Event::Bail->new( 8 trace => Test2::EventFacet::Trace->new(frame => ['foo', 'foo.t', 42]), 27 package => 'Test2::Event::Bail', 54 package => 'Test2::Event::Bail',
|
| /openbsd/src/gnu/usr.bin/perl/cpan/Test-Simple/lib/Test2/ |
| D | Event.pm | 1 package Test2::Event; 10 use Test2::Util::HashBase qw/trace -amnesty uuid -_eid -hubs/; 11 use Test2::Util::ExternalMeta qw/meta get_meta set_meta delete_meta/; 12 use Test2::Util qw/pkg_to_file gen_uid/; 14 use Test2::EventFacet::About(); 15 use Test2::EventFacet::Amnesty(); 16 use Test2::EventFacet::Assert(); 17 use Test2::EventFacet::Control(); 18 use Test2::EventFacet::Error(); 19 use Test2::EventFacet::Info(); [all …]
|
| D | IPC.pm | 1 package Test2::IPC; 8 use Test2::API::Instance; 9 use Test2::Util qw/get_tid/; 10 use Test2::API qw{ 37 sub unimport { Test2::API::test2_ipc_disable() } 42 confess "IPC is disabled" if Test2::API::test2_ipc_disabled(); 46 Test2::API::_set_ipc(_make_ipc()); 54 my ($driver) = Test2::API::test2_ipc_drivers(); 56 require Test2::IPC::Driver::Files;
|
| D | API.pm | 1 package Test2::API; 6 use Test2::Util qw/USE_THREADS/; 38 my $trace = Test2::EventFacet::Trace->new( 41 my $ctx = Test2::API::Context->new( 51 use Test2::API::Instance(\$INST); 77 if($] ge '5.014' || $ENV{T2_CHECK_DEPTH} || $Test2::API::DO_DEPTH_CHECK) { 85 use Test2::EventFacet::Trace(); 86 use Test2::Util::Trace(); # Legacy 88 use Test2::Hub::Subtest(); 89 use Test2::Hub::Interceptor(); [all …]
|
| /openbsd/src/gnu/usr.bin/perl/cpan/Test-Simple/t/Test2/modules/Tools/ |
| D | Tiny.t | 4 use Test2::IPC; 5 use Test2::Tools::Tiny; 7 use Test2::API qw/context intercept test2_stack/; 79 my ($plan, $ok, $is, $isnt, $like, $unlike, $is_deeply) = grep {!$_->isa('Test2::Event::Diag')} @$m… 82 ok($plan->isa('Test2::Event::Plan'), "got plan"); 85 ok($ok->isa('Test2::Event::Fail'), "got 'ok' result"); 88 ok($is->isa('Test2::Event::Fail'), "got 'is' result"); 91 ok($isnt->isa('Test2::Event::Fail'), "got 'isnt' result"); 94 ok($like->isa('Test2::Event::Fail'), "got 'like' result"); 97 ok($unlike->isa('Test2::Event::Fail'), "got 'unlike' result"); [all …]
|
| /openbsd/src/gnu/usr.bin/perl/cpan/Test-Simple/t/Test2/modules/Hub/ |
| D | Subtest.t | 3 use Test2::Tools::Tiny; 5 use Test2::Hub::Subtest; 6 use Test2::Util qw/get_tid/; 42 my $one = Test2::Hub::Subtest->new( 46 ok($one->isa('Test2::Hub'), "inheritance"); 50 local *Test2::Hub::process = sub { $ran++; (undef, $event) = @_; 'P!' }; 53 my $ok = Test2::Event::Ok->new( 56 trace => Test2::EventFacet::Trace->new(frame => [__PACKAGE__, __FILE__, __LINE__, 'xxx']), 67 my $bail = Test2::Event::Bail->new( 69 trace => Test2::EventFacet::Trace->new(frame => [__PACKAGE__, __FILE__, __LINE__, 'xxx']), [all …]
|
| /openbsd/src/gnu/usr.bin/perl/cpan/Test-Simple/t/Test2/modules/IPC/ |
| D | Driver.t | 4 use Test2::IPC::Driver::Files; 6 use Test2::Tools::Tiny; 7 use Test2::API qw/context test2_ipc_drivers/; 9 Test2::IPC::Driver::Files->import(); 10 Test2::IPC::Driver::Files->import(); 11 Test2::IPC::Driver::Files->import(); 15 ['Test2::IPC::Driver::Files'], 20 my $one = Test2::IPC::Driver->new; 31 my $one = Test2::IPC::Driver->new(no_fatal => 1);
|
| /openbsd/src/gnu/usr.bin/perl/cpan/Test-Simple/lib/Test2/Hub/ |
| D | Subtest.pm | 1 package Test2::Hub::Subtest; 7 BEGIN { require Test2::Hub; our @ISA = qw(Test2::Hub) } 8 use Test2::Util::HashBase qw/nested exit_code manual_skip_all/; 9 use Test2::Util qw/get_tid/; 25 *ID = \&Test2::Hub::HID; 26 *id = \&Test2::Hub::hid; 27 *set_id = \&Test2::Hub::set_hid;
|
| /openbsd/src/gnu/usr.bin/perl/cpan/Test-Simple/lib/Test2/Event/ |
| D | Pass.pm | 1 package Test2::Event::Pass; 7 use Test2::EventFacet::Info; 10 require Test2::Event; 12 *META_KEY = \&Test2::Util::ExternalMeta::META_KEY; 15 use Test2::Util::HashBase qw{ -name -info }; 37 $in = Test2::EventFacet::Info->new($in);
|
| D | Fail.pm | 1 package Test2::Event::Fail; 7 use Test2::EventFacet::Info; 10 require Test2::Event; 12 *META_KEY = \&Test2::Util::ExternalMeta::META_KEY; 15 use Test2::Util::HashBase qw{ -name -info }; 42 $in = Test2::EventFacet::Info->new($in);
|
| /openbsd/src/gnu/usr.bin/perl/cpan/Test-Simple/t/Test2/modules/API/ |
| D | Instance.t | 4 use Test2::IPC; 5 use Test2::Tools::Tiny; 6 use Test2::Util qw/CAN_THREAD CAN_REALLY_FORK USE_THREADS get_tid/; 16 my $CLASS = 'Test2::API::Instance'; 142 is($one->formatter, 'Test2::Formatter::TAP', "got specified formatter"); 145 local $ENV{T2_FORMATTER} = '+Test2::Formatter::TAP'; 147 is($one->formatter, 'Test2::Formatter::TAP', "got specified formatter"); 190 is(Test2::API::Instance::_ipc_wait, 0, "No errors"); 198 is(Test2::API::Instance::_ipc_wait, 255, "Process exited badly"); 209 is(Test2::API::Instance::_ipc_wait, 255, "Process exited badly"); [all …]
|
| D | InterceptResult.t | 5 use Test2::Tools::Tiny; 6 use Test2::API::InterceptResult; 8 use Test2::API qw/intercept context/; 10 my $CLASS = 'Test2::API::InterceptResult'; 45 require Test2::Event::Pass; 46 …my $event = Test2::Event::Pass->new(name => 'soup for you', trace => {frame => ['foo', 'foo.pl', 4… 47 ok($event->isa('Test2::Event'), "Start with an event"); 51 ok($up->isa('Test2::API::InterceptResult::Event'), "Upgraded the event"); 63 require Test2::Event::V2; 64 my $subtest = 'Test2::Event::V2'->new( [all …]
|